bootstrap table 父子表实现【无限级】菜单管理功能

bootstrap table 父子表实现【无限级】菜单管理功能

实现效果

bootstrap table 父子表实现【无限级】菜单管理功能_第1张图片

前端代码


<%@ page        language="java"        import="java.util.*"        pageEncoding="UTF-8" %>
<%@include file="/WEB-INF/include/tags.jsp" %>



    
	
	
	
	
	
 	
	
	
	
    


    



菜单列表

上方代码需要修改的地方:

  • 标签中所有的引用需要修改。 推荐cdn:https://www.bootcdn.cn/
  • 数据源 需要修改为自身服务端的请求地址

服务端代码:

    @RequestMapping("/")
    @ResponseBody
    public Map menuData(String pid, String search, String order, Integer offset, Integer limit) {

        logger.info("  menuData()   pid   " + pid);
        logger.info("  menuData()   search   " + search);
        logger.info("  menuData()   order   " + order);
        logger.info("  menuData()   offset   " + offset);
        logger.info("  menuData()   limit   " + limit);

        Map resultMap = new HashMap<>();

        List menuList = menuService.selectAllMenuByPid(pid, null);


        resultMap.put("menuList", menuList);

        return resultMap;
    }

参考地址:

官方示例程序:https://examples.bootstrap-table.com/#welcomes/sub-table.html
博客API翻译:https://blog.csdn.net/S_clifftop/article/details/77937356
博客API翻译:https://blog.csdn.net/rickiyeat/article/details/56483577

你可能感兴趣的:(bootstrap table 父子表实现【无限级】菜单管理功能)